Maintenance Technician | Bakery Equipment & Facility Support
Location: Mokena, IL
Shift: 2nd Shift (5:00 PM – 3:30 AM); weekend availability required.
Pay: $30–$38 /hr (based on experience) – annual salary $62,000–$80,000.
Role SummaryThe Maintenance Technician will support day‑to‑day production by maintaining bakery equipment, responding to breakdowns, and performing preventive maintenance across mixers, ovens, conveyors, packaging lines, and facility systems in a fast‑paced food manufacturing environment.
Minimum Requirements- 2+ years of mechanical maintenance experience in food, bakery, or high‑speed manufacturing.
- Experience maintaining Auto‑Bake Serpentine ovens.
- Strong troubleshooting skills in pneumatics, hydraulics, and mechanical systems.
- Comfortable working in fast‑paced environments and able to independently solve issues.
- Ability to read equipment manuals, schematics, and basic mechanical diagrams.
- Must have own hand tools; secure onsite toolbox provided.
- Bilingual (English/Spanish).
- Welding/fabrication experience.
- Familiarity with automated bakery systems and industrial ovens.
-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and work at heights.
- Ability to work around heat and noise in a food production setting.

- Troubleshoot and repair mechanical issues on mixers, ovens, conveyors, cooling tunnels, and automated packaging equipment.
- Perform preventive maintenance and equipment inspections to minimize downtime.
- Support changeovers and production line setups.
- Replace worn parts (belts, bearings, sprockets, seals, etc.).
- Maintain pneumatic and hydraulic systems, including leak repairs and valve adjustments.
- Operate forklifts, scissor lifts, and power tools safely.
- Conduct minor fabrication tasks (cutting, grinding, drilling).
- Document repairs, parts usage, and downtime activity.
- Follow GMPs, PPE use, and lockout/tagout procedures.
- Collaborate with Production, Quality, and Sanitation teams to maintain a clean and efficient operation.
